			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img class="alignright size-medium wp-image-40" title="business performance" src="http://bizcenture.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/01/business-performance-300x190.jpg" alt="business performance" width="220" height="168" />If a company is running well and making profits, then chances are that the senior executives are well acquainted with business performance management. They may not have a technical definition of the concept but will have acquired the knowledge and skills to apply it practically within their areas of responsibility.  There are a number of related terms that have been used to explain business performance management (BPM).</p>
<p>These include but are not limited to operational performance management (OPM), business performance optimization (BPO), corporate performance management (CPA) and enterprise performance management (EPM). Despite the difference both operate on one principle which attempts to increase the efficiency and profitability of the organization right up to the optimum level.<span id="more-39"></span></p>
<p>In order to achieve this aim, the organization has to muster all its resources whether it is human capital or <a href="http://bizitc.com/performance/information-technology-aids-in-business-growth/">technology aids</a> with the overriding aim of reducing costs, <a href="http://businessmp.com/whitepapers/productivity-and-values-enhancement-with-business-performance-management/">increasing output and growing profits</a>. The challenge is getting all departments to understand their work in times of increasing efficiency and profitability. Many of them will have vested interests and their own agendas. The institutional culture that you have encouraged in your company will also have an impact in terms of the extent to which staff members are willing to join your efforts at performance management.</p>
<p><img class="alignright size-medium wp-image-45" title="change management" src="http://bizcenture.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/01/change-management-300x260.jpg" alt="change management" width="200" height="160" />Evidence shows that performance management process does go hand in hand with change management. In order to prioritize the company’s core objective, there will have to be significant period of organizational change. Where there is change culture resistance is not far off. It will take a lot of work to get the whole <a href="http://bizcenture.com/knowledge-base/managing-processes-within-the-business-performance-management-context/">organization to work in sync</a>. The larger the organization the greater the complexity of effecting change.</p>
<p>Performance management by its very nature seeks to create minimum <a href="http://businessmp.com/whitepapers/business-performance-metrics-indicators-of-business-performance-and-growth/">performance standards</a>. It can create rewards and sanctions depending on the level of compliance. The strategic nature of its operations means that it often takes precedence over the day to day routine. It also creates a fear of management as people may believe that their jobs are being restructured and will eventually disappear from the payroll.</p>
<p>Performance management is a process and not just an incident. It is imperative that there is a <a href="http://bizcenture.com/performance-management/overcoming-institutional-culture-in-business-performance-management-implementation/">continuous assessment</a> in order to ensure that the changes and performance standards are not a one-off administered in haste but part of a well planned strategy to improve performance. Staff members should be encouraged to record the results of their own work and review their own performance in line with the standards that have been set.</p>
<p>There is always a risk that business performance management is created and supervised as a top-down activity. This is an approach that is likely to attract the <a href="http://bizcenture.com/performance-management/overcoming-institutional-culture-in-business-performance-management-implementation/">stiffest resistance from members</a> of staff who may feel that they are being dictated to by management. Rather efforts should be made to ensure that even the lowest employee believes that performance management is in their best interests.  If they are to do well then the rewards will go to them in terms of promotion and better conditions.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img class="alignright size-medium wp-image-21" title="IT in Healthcare" src="http://bizcenture.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/01/IT-in-Healthcare-300x214.jpg" alt="IT in Healthcare" width="200" height="180" />As we have aware of, one of the key talking points in advancing the cause of health care access to American citizens was the ability to create savings by adjusting the business information technology structures that currently exist in the healthcare system of the USA in both the private sector and public sector. Despite being the leading power in the world, the USA government has consistently struggled to provide health care access to millions of its citizens.</p>
<p>There is a debate to be had about whether the government should be involved anyway. However the limits of this article do not allow for such extensive debate. Needless to say there is a general consensus that the Information Technology systems existing in many healthcare systems across the world are quite expensive and often do not meet the needs of the end users.<span id="more-20"></span></p>
<p>There have been various examples of government departments or private companies commissioning large business<a href="http://bizcenture.com/perspective/aligning-information-technology-system-in-healthcare-sector/"> IT systems to administer healthcare</a> only to later discover that these are either inappropriate or way over budget. The government sectors are particularly notorious for this. They get sold on by smooth sales people who juggle management speak for the benefit of bored managers.</p>
<p><img class="alignright size-medium wp-image-22" title="Healthcare IT system" src="http://bizcenture.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/01/Healthcare-IT-system-300x199.jpg" alt="Healthcare IT system" width="220" height="169" />Just to get an easy life, the IT system is commissioned anyway. This is despite some opposition from a lower ranked employee who, knowing how the business works on a day to day basis, will already have worked out that the new IT systems will not be able to deliver the kind of service that is required. When that employee begins to experience problems with the IT system, they are reprimanded for being resistant to change.</p>
<p>Once the complaints grow then the IT system is temporarily withdrawn until further investigation. Either the whole thing will be shelved or the company will join the vicious cycle of organizations that have to update or replace inappropriate technology systems.</p>
<p>This is the type of scenario that is played out like some tragedy over and over again. For some this is costly and unacceptable in such a sensitive industry that affects the personal lives of millions of people. Where it is government funded, this sort of business IT mismanagement takes resources away from other critical activities and reduces the scope of coverage when attempting to deliver healthcare services. What then is the solution for preventing such problems or dealing with them once they have overcome?</p>
<p>One of the more persuasive suggestions is that all stakeholders should be involved in selecting new information technology. There will be a divergence of need between a clinician, an administrator, a senior manager and a patient. Even the IT technician will have their own perspective as to what needs to work. Rather than selectively consult with just one among the many groups, it is far better to consult with them all. It might take a bit longer than would normally be required but the end result is that <a href="http://bizcenture.com/perspective/aligning-information-technology-system-in-healthcare-sector/">healthcare IT systems</a> will be durable and appropriate to the people who use them.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Processes are the story that describes the reality of the business performance management program. It is therefore important to ensure that the responsible officers are aware of the processes and have the tools or aptitudes that are required to <a href="http://bizcenture.com/knowledge-base/managing-processes-within-the-business-performance-management-context/">monitor process and manage it</a> effectively. The failure of a business performance program is a direct result of failing to manage processes. Woe to those who take a perfunctory attitude. The goals will mean nothing if you cannot competently map the journey.</p>
<p>The first thing to recognize that process means that activities are interrelated. The negligence of one part will lead to the collapse of other parts. The need to keep a strategic perspective to any activities will become even more acute if there is a particular problem with a process that requires undue attention from the managers. If a consequence of this attention is that other parts of the project fail, then it will show a lack of attention to the idea of strategic oversight.<br />
<img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-4" title="business performance management" src="http://bizcenture.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/01/business-performance-management.jpg" alt="business performance management" width="400" height="255" /><span id="more-3"></span><br />
The manager cannot be expected to know every aspect of a business process but what they must know are the implications of that process on the business. You can get away with not knowing what something is as long as you understand the role it plays. Subordinates will be able to assist in getting over the detail. The responsibility for executive action over process links is a serious matter.</p>
<p>Structure also has a role to play here. The manager does not need to dictate every single convolution of a business process. However they could be well advised to create a template of minimum standards to which each team can work. The lack of structure has been known to work very well amongst creative people but given the importance of business performance management, this approach is less desirable. Therefore as a minimum the various aspects of the organization should be structured enough to at least be able to communicate and work with other departments.</p>
<p>Managers need to be aware of the <a href="http://bizcenture.com/knowledge-base/managing-processes-within-the-business-performance-management-context/">evolutionary nature of business processes</a>. This is a necessary progression for them to either cope with change or as a result of innovation by different members of the organization. The manager should not be in a mindset where they have a prepared negative answer to any form of request from the teams to change the processes. This sparks of traditionalism and failure to consider that innovation can be harnessed even during a performance management exercise.</p>
<p>On the other hand the manager also needs to be weary of those employees who change things just for the sake of changing things. They will suggest innovations that add little value to the business but create an awful lot of trouble and work for everyone else. Others might be on an ego trip and will be looking to impress managers with their endless proposals for improvement. The key is to strike a balance between allowing genuine innovation to flourish and preventing unnecessary shocks to the existing business systems in the name of giving overzealous employees an energy rush.</p>
